What is driving Coherent Corp (COHR)’s stock price up today?

The upward movement in Coherent Corp. shares was primarily driven by sector-wide thematic rotation into optical communications and photonics hardware, as institutional investors continue to pivot into companies positioned at the core of artificial intelligence data center buildouts. High-speed optical connectivity remains a central focus of capital expenditure among hyperscalers transitioning from legacy copper to advanced optical interconnects. The broader rally across photonics suppliers underscored market appetite for high-bandwidth infrastructure plays, providing strong tailwinds for the stock relative to the wider market.

Reinforcing this bullish momentum was the company's recent launch of an upgraded pluggable optical line system featuring high-power amplification optimized for high-capacity optics. By integrating critical transport capabilities directly into compact form factors tailored for AI data centers and cloud networks, Coherent has demonstrated direct product execution tied to immediate hyperscaler demand. Confirmation that this system is already shipping in volume to major cloud customers strengthens visibility around datacenter revenue and reinforces the company's competitive standing in high-speed optical transceivers.

Underlying institutional confidence is supported by the company's fundamental trajectory, highlighted by recent quarterly results featuring record revenue and expanding gross margins driven by data center hardware. While high valuation multiples and recent broader sector volatility have led to intraday price swings, market sentiment remains largely anchored by tight optical supply conditions expected to persist alongside persistent long-term AI infrastructure spending.

Company Specific Risks:

  • Macro & AI Sector Spending Sensitivity: Intraday volatility across optics and photonics makers has intensified following broader technology sector pullbacks and cautious industry commentary regarding the pace of AI capital deployment, exposing high-beta suppliers like Coherent to sudden sector rotation and hyperscaler capital expenditure uncertainties.
  • Elevated Valuation Disconnect: Valuation metrics highlight that Coherent trades at an aggressive Price-to-Sales ratio exceeding 8.2x—substantially above its historical median of 2.2x—and an elevated forward earnings multiple, leaving the stock highly vulnerable to sharp price corrections if growth decelerates.
  • Sustained Insider Liquidations: SEC Form 4 and Form 144 filings disclose continued open-market share sales by directors and executives, reinforcing institutional caution as aggregate insider selling reached over $1.1 billion over the past 12 months with zero insider purchases.
  • Indium Phosphide Capacity & Execution Bottlenecks: Operational performance remains heavily dependent on rapidly ramping 6-inch Indium Phosphide (InP) substrate manufacturing, where any yield drop or production delay could cap transceiver shipments and trigger execution-driven earnings downgrades.
